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hazel Grove to Stratford International start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hazel Grove to Stratford International start from £78.90 one way, or £112.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hazel Grove to Stratford International are available for £200.10 one way, or £400.20 return

Facilities & Services at Hazel Grove Station

The station is equipped with various amenities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. For ticketing needs, Hazel Grove offers a dedicated ticket office with extensive opening hours from as early as 6:05 AM, and smartcard facilities provide an added layer of convenience. There are ticket machines available, including accessible ones, making it easy for everyone to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y new ones with ease.

Travelers will appreciate the station's commitment to accessibility. There's step-free access throughout the whole station and ramps available for train access. While there are accessible toilets on platform 1 stocked with RADAR keys, baby changing facilities are not available. Hazel Grove prides itself on security, boasting CCTV surveillance for peace of mind.

Bicycle enthusiasts can secure their rides at one of the 23 available spaces, including cycle lockers and stands within the car park. Although the station lacks refreshment facilities and an ATM, a kiosk shop on-site caters to immediate needs. Payphones are also available, although Wi-Fi isn't provided at the station.

Seamless Onward Travel Connections

Getting to and from Hazel Grove station is hassle-free thanks to its robust transport links. Rail replacement services utilize Bus Stop B in the station's car park, ensuring continuity even if train services are disrupted. The adjoining bus services link commuters to nearby towns such as Stockport, Glossop, or Marple, each offering their unique character and attractions.

Taxi services are at your fingertips via Cab4You, adding another layer to your travel flexibility. Plus, bicycle hire is readily available, expanding your mobility options within the local area, accessible via TfGM Cycling.

A Spectrum of Facilities

The station is well-equipped with facilities to make your journey comfortable and efficient. The ticket office operates from 06:15 to 22: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 09:30 to 17:30 on Sundays, complemented by ticket machines that accommodate all travelers, including those with disabilities. If you're collecting pre-purchased tickets, simply head to one of the designated machines. Located in the booking hall, these machines are designed for accessibility, ensuring ease for all travelers.

For passenger assistance, customers can seek help from various help points throughout the station, whether it's from the staff, information points, or through announcements displayed on numerous screens. While there isn’t luggage storage available, Stratford International remains a secure station with comprehensive CCTV coverage.

If you have some time before your train, indulge in a cup of coffee at the refreshment facilities or grab essentials from WH Smiths. The station also features ATMs for your convenience. However, if you're planning to bring your own bicycle, you’ll find 66 stands available for bike parking, albeit at your own risk.

Accessibility at Its Core

Ensuring accessibility is a core aim of Stratford International. The station offers step-free access throughout, including lifts connecting all platforms. Accessible toilets and ticket machines make the station inclusive, and passengers can request assistance up to two hours before their travel through the Passenger Assist service.

Seamless Onward Connections

Stratford International is not just about trains; it's a multimodal transport hub. Situated near the Docklands Light Railway (DLR), passengers can easily connect to the London Underground and explore a vast range of destinations. Taxis are readily accessible at the Westfield Shopping Centre entrance, and if there are any disruptions, a rail replacement service operates from the station forecourt.
